    I didn't see any other threads and wanted to know if anyone is running Parallels Desktop 5 on a Macbook Pro (Mid 2009) with 8GB of RAM?

    Newegg has an 8GB memory kit at a almost reasonable price so I think I'm make the plunge. Despite having 4GB of RAM already, I think I've been dancing around bush trying to run 1GB Windows 7 guest and a busy MacOS host. Using iStat, I've seen MacOS swap upto a 1GB of memory into swap, which really throws the machine into a crawl. I've upgraded to a 7200RPM disk to better handle the swap, but in hindsight, I'm pretty sure going with more memory is probably the better bang for the buck.

    Does anyone foresee issues with Parallels running on an 8GB host?
